OBJECTIVE To investigate whether nimesulide can suppress tumor growth and induce apoptosis in SGC-7901 gastric cancer cells and to explore the molecular mechanism involved. METHODS SGC-7901 cells were cultured in RPMI 1640 medium con- taining different concentrations of nimesulide (0,12.5, 50, 100, 200, 400 Mmol/L). The MTT assay, morphological observation, electron microscopy (EM), immunohistochemical analysis and Western blot analysis were em- ployed to investigate the effects of nimesulide on the SGC-7901 cells and to explore possible related molecular mechanisms. RESULTS Nimesulide inhibited the growth of SGC-7901 cells and elicit- ed typical apoptotic morphologic changes. Nimesulide also decreased NF-κB and Bcl-2 expression, but increased the level of the Bax protein. The positive rate of Bcl -2 protein expression at 0, 50, 100 and 200 μmol/L of nimesulide was 58.3±14.0%, 50.2±9.9%, 32.8±5.0% and 22.7± 5.5% respectively based on immunohistochemical staining. The positive rate of Bax protein expression was 22.0 ±5.7%, 29.2 ±6.5%, 42.7 ±5.9% and 74.5±9.1% and the NF-κB expression was 74.2+10.9%, 61.8±7.6%, 36.7 ±10.9% and 17.5 ±12.3%, Significant differences were found be- tween 0 μmol/L and 100 μmoI/L and 200 μmol/L. Western blot analysis al- so showed that the expression of NF-κB was decreased. CONCLUSION Nimesulide suppresses tumor growth and induces apop- tosis by inhibiting NF-κB expression, which may be related to the over- expression of Bax relative to Bcl-2 expression.
